#0b4cac h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#0b4cac is composed of 4.3% red, 29.8%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.6% cyan, 55.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 215.8 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 35.9%. #0b4cac color hex could be obtained by blending #1698ff with #000059.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

● #0b4cac color description : D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#0b4cac has RGB values of R:11, G:76,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 740524.
